Chapter 23 A Resurrection and a GhostIt was soon evident that the Princess Y—— had taken her new maid into her confidence to a certain extent. She must have rung for Fauchette without my hearing anything, for presently the door opened again, and I heard my assistant’s voice. As the result of a hurried consultation between the two women, in which Fauchette played to perfection the part of a devoted maid who is only desirous to anticipate the wishes of her mistress, it was decided to wheel the sofa on which I lay into the oratory, and to bring the wax dummy into the Princess’s bedroom, to lie in state till the next day.
